Open the castle town

Taketa city, Oita, next to Kumamoto is a town of central Kyusyu and has a population of about 20,000. The center is a castle town surrounded by the mountain on all sides and remain unique atmosphere such as a section of the city and width of a road. However, there are few people who walk around the town and people of the town proceed with “A project of regeneration castle town” to overcome the situation and the vanguard is to rebuild of the library.

 

In this plan, they carried out “A dividing of roof” and “A separation roof and wall” adopting a gable roof and a white wall in view of affinity with a scene of the castle town. And they tried to drop an environment of the castle town like light, wind and scene in three-dimensional into an architecture from a space which come out from there. Internal of the architecture form a space integrated into one which the air volume is large and characterizing each place are bookshelves.

 

They circle in the building while they curve gently like the flow of water and wind. The arrangement came from taking in an architecture the flow of wind which trend unidirectionally year-round. Bookshelves encourage the movement of visitant by this form and make a space depending on each place by height which changes in various way. They tried to make room which has a feature, for example south open shelves like a light plain, north open shelves like a silent forest and open shelves on the second floor like close cave.

 

  At castle town, the town never extend and the elements of scenes like the section, the width of a road, roof, wall also never change. These things which never change make this city. Based on it, we cross the section and cultivate the site, moreover open the roof and wall to take in  the environment of the castle town, and make a place to encourage movement of people. That is opening of the castle town from “Steady order” which the town has. We got a feeling that a new city starts to act from here.

 

Material Used :
1. Structure in: Reinforced concrete construction, steel construction, and steel framed reinforced concrete structure
2. Facades in: Please refer to Outdoor surfaces


Indoor surfaces: 
Open-shelves library room
1. Floors:Vinyl weave tile carpet
2. Walls: Painted plasterboard
3. Ceilings: Painted steel expanded metal


Tatami room
1. Floors: Tatami
2. Walls: Perforated non-combustible cedar decorative plate
3. Ceilings: Painted woodwool cement board


Open-shelves library room on the second floor
1. Floors: Tile carpet
2. Walls: Painted plasterboard, glass
3. Ceilings: Painted Steel expanded metal, glass


Outdoor surfaces:
1. Roof: Phosphoric acid treated stainless plate
2. Walls: Ceramic hybrid fine ultra-low-pollution paint, Painted steel expanded metal on extruded cement board, Painted extruded cement board
3. Floors: Please refer to Indoor surfaces
